// Vertiqo elevator-dispatch simulator: core tuning module.
//
// These constants shape how the dispatcher weighs wait time
// against car travel distance, and how aggressively it
// re-assigns calls when a car stalls at a floor. Release
// builds must ship with the values validated against the
// Halbrook tower trace set; deviations change throughput
// numbers quoted in the release notes. Do not hot-patch
// these in production images. The validated set for this
// release is given below.

limits module of fajog-tawig:
RATE_LIMITS = {
    "druwyn": 2,
    "quenael": 10,
    "wenix": 2,
    "druael": 2,
}

## Changelog — tailfox v2.4.0

Changed defaults for the internal log-tailing CLI. Previously, tailfox followed rotated files silently and buffered up to 10k lines, which caused confusing gaps during the Pinewharf incident. We now surface rotation events explicitly and cap the buffer lower, trading throughput for predictability. Maintainers should note that anyone relying on the old silent-rotation behavior must opt in via flag. After careful review with the platform group, the shipped defaults are as follows:

config for yajep-tafof:
[rusath]
team = julmir
access_code = ac_fe37fd
host = rusath.novactech.test
port = 8000
owner = pelmir.weneth
peer = oliwyn.olvarqdyn.internal

Subject: Handover — Sproutline watering scheduler

Hi,

Effective with the 2.6 release, ownership of the Sproutline plant-watering scheduler is changing. Please route all cut-off approvals, hotfix sign-offs, and cron-window changes to the new owner rather than the greenhouse integrations list. Open tickets have already been reassigned; nothing else changes for the release checklist. The new responsible engineer is named below.

named custodian: Brivan Eliath Quenox Frador

Subject: DR drill Thursday — config hot-reload

Team,

Thursday 09:00 we run the disaster-recovery drill for Pinwheel's config service. We'll kill the primary and confirm hot-reload picks up the fallback settings without restarts. Watch the support queue; expect brief alert noise. Do not page platform unless reloads fail twice. To unlock the drill runbook vault, use the recovery passphrase below.

unlock words, yawig-kagef: gordor-holvan-ulaael-pramir-ulaiel-tamdor